Chelsea fans will love what Moises Caicedo has now done in training at Cobham after his eventful debut on Sunday.

The Ecuador international struggled in his 30-minute cameo against West Ham, giving away a penalty in the dying stages to hand the east Londoners a 3-1 win.

However – after some time to forget about that debut – Moises Caicedo has now shown Chelsea fans what he’s all about in training.

Well, the South American is one of the best tacklers in Europe, and his strongest trait was on show for all to see at Cobham – after he scored a screamer, that is.

Caicedo could be seen embarrassing Mason Burstow in a 14-second video posted by Chelsea earlier on Wednesday, feinting one way to fool the 20-year-old before rifling a rocket into the roof of the net as Mauricio Pochettino watched on in the background.

The 21-year-old then immediately dispossessed Burstow straight after the Londoner was given the ball back, with the Ecuadorian’s tackle flying into the top corner. The Chelsea No.25 didn’t even need to shoot.

As Pochettino watched on alongside Jesus Perez – the Argentine’s assistant – both were surely delighted to see this moment of quality from the £115m man.
